Mesothelioma Claims

Many patients diagnosed with mesothelioma and their families claim compensation. The compensation could come from trust funds, lawsuit payouts or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) benefits.

A law firm that has experience in mesothelioma cases can help victims and loved ones get the justice they deserve. A mesothelioma lawyer could make the process easy.

Work History

Mesothelioma patients can claim compensation under a variety of insurance. Individuals diagnosed with Mesothelioma can bring a personal injury lawsuit against asbestos-related companies that exposed them. Compensation may be awarded to cover medical expenses, lost wages and funeral expenses.

Mesothelioma lawsuits can result in significant awards which can assist patients and their families recover from the terrible effects of this disease. These lawsuits also hold accountable those companies responsible for asbestos and encourage them to stop the risk of exposure to asbestos in the future.

Veterans who were exposed to asbestos while serving in Armed forces could be eligible for veteran benefits, such as disability payments. The compensation from VA benefits can assist families in paying for mesothelioma treatment and other expenses associated with the disease.

Mesothelioma sufferers can work with an attorney to determine if they are eligible to file a lawsuit or trust fund. Depending on the type claim that you file, you may be required to gather medical documents, work history, and other evidence in order to prove your claim.

Expert mesothelioma lawyers will know the best way for gathering and analyzing this evidence to ensure that all legal rights are secured. They can also work with health insurance companies as well as the VA to ensure that all compensation resources are accessible.

Individuals who are diagnosed with mesothelioma can also gain compensation through asbestos trust funds. Many asbestos companies have established trusts to compensate injured people without resorting to litigation.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ist people determine if their asbestos exposure was covered by a trust, and help them navigate the process of claiming.

The funds provide compensation based on the asbestos exposure of a person as well as their diagnosis. However, the funds are limited and some have already reached their limit. In the end, eligible victims must consider filing with multiple trusts.

Mesothelioma lawyers with national connections can assist people make this decision. They can also assist in the coordination of mesothelioma cases and trust fund claims to ensure that the client receives maximum compensation.

Asbestos Exposure

Asbestos victims can claim compensation if they suffer from mesothelioma or another asbestos-related disease. This can be used to pay for medical expenses as well as other expenses related to treatment. Compensation can also give victims peace of mind and support for their families. A mesothelioma lawyer can guide individuals through the claims process and ensure that their legal rights are secured.

Mesothelioma is a form of cancer that affects the thin membranes that surround the body's organs and joints. It is usually caused by exposure to asbestos, which is a class of minerals with microscopic fibres. These fibres can easily be inhaled or eaten, causing lung damage. In the 20th century, asbestos was utilized in a variety of applications.

Asbestos victims can file lawsuits against manufacturers who exposed them to this harmful material. These lawsuits could result in a settlement with court or a decision in court. Many mesothelioma cases are settled before they reach trial.

A certified asbestos lawyer can examine the work history of the patient to determine when and where they were exposed. The attorneys can then determine the responsible parties. This could include asbestos-related companies, manufacturers of asbestos-containing items, shipyards and construction materials.

The extent of exposure to asbestos can significantly improve the strength of a mesothelioma case. Asbestos lawyers can examine medical documents, laboratory tests and other evidence to determine a patient's asbestos exposure and the severity of their mesothelioma.

In some instances the family members of a mesothelioma patient may file a wrongful death claim to pursue compensation on his or her behalf. A lawyer can help families learn about the time limit for mesothelioma, as well as other regulations and rules applicable to these kinds of cases.

Additionally, mesothelioma patients and their families can apply for workers benefits such as disability or workers' compensation. These benefits can cover lost income or assist in paying for expenses for living. Patients with mesothelioma may also be eligible for a special monthly payments from Veterans Affairs.

Employer's Negligence

In certain situations you could be in a position to hold your employer accountable for the asbestos exposure you suffered. If your employer was negligent in not providing a safe work environment or didn't properly prepare employees, you could be eligible for compensation.

A successful claim can pay for mesothelioma treatment medical bills, lost income and other expenses related to the illness. A mesothelioma attorney can assist you in filing a claim against the right person or entity.

The majority of mesothelioma cases are resolved via a settlement instead of a verdict in court. The timeline for this process can vary depending on your unique circumstances and the nature of the claim you are filing.

Your attorney can use legal theories such as negligence or strict liability as well as breach of warranty when bringing an action to prove that the defendant is accountable for the damages you suffer. Mesothelioma cases often require a great deal of evidence, including medical reports and laboratory test results.

If you've been diagnosed with mesothelioma, then you might be eligible to receive compensation from an asbestos trust fund. However, it is important to know that the compensation you are entitled to is only a portion of the trust's total assets. This is to ensure that the cash in the trust doesn't run out while paying victims claims. Victims who qualify can file compensation claims with multiple asbestos trusts.

For those who have been diagnosed with mesothelioma it is essential to seek legal counsel as soon as you can. A mesothelioma attorney will be able discuss your options with you and recommend the best path for you.

In the UK Compensation claims for asbestos exposure may be brought against occupiers, employers and manufacturers and suppliers, who failed to protect their workers. This is regardless of whether the business is no longer operating.

Statute of Limitations

A statute of limitations is a law that defines the maximum time victims must file a lawsuit. The time frame for the statute of limitations may vary from state to state and depending on the nature of the claim. Mesothelioma lawsuits have different statutes than other personal injury lawsuits. This is due to the fact that mesothelioma may take years to manifest, and a lot of victims won't know they have the disease until they are diagnosed with it.

It is therefore important that patients with mesothelioma contact an attorney as soon as they can. A specialist will be able to ensure that the victim has a claim filed on time and be able to assist them compile the necessary documentation for the case.

Any company that exposes a victim to asbestos can be sued and that includes the insurance companies of the responsible party. Victims can seek compensation for medical expenses, pain and suffering, and other damages. They can also get an award to replace the loss of income resulting from the inability to work due to illness.

Mesothelioma victims' families can also file wrongful death lawsuits against the responsible parties. Generally, the statute of limitations for a wrongful death claim is when the victim dies. Certain states have rules that allow the statute of limitation clock to begin when a victim is diagnosed with mesothelioma.

It is crucial to file a claim for mesothelioma as soon as you can because the evidence will fade with time. Certain states have shorter statutes for asbestos cases than others.

The statute of limitations in a mesothelioma case will depend on where the defendants reside and where the victim resides or worked. In general, a mesothelioma lawsuit should be filed in the state in which the exposure occurred.

It is also crucial that a mesothelioma lawyer be aware of the specific statutes of limitations for every state. This will ensure that a claim is filed in time and the victim doesn't lose their right to a fair settlement.
